5G Fixed Wireless Access Market: The Structural Shift Toward Private Enterprise Wireless Networks
The global telecommunications and digital infrastructure
industries are experiencing an unprecedented transformation, with 5G Fixed
Wireless Access (FWA) architectures serving as a cornerstone for modern
broadband delivery. Fixed Wireless Access represents an innovative network
deployment paradigm that utilizes high-speed cellular radio links rather than
traditional physical fiber-optic, copper, or coaxial cables to provide
high-bandwidth internet connectivity to fixed locations, such as residential
homes and commercial business facilities. Driven by the surging demand for
high-speed internet, expanding remote work frameworks, and the heavy
infrastructure investments required for fiber rollouts, 5G FWA has moved from
an alternative rural solution into a primary gigabit-broadband option for
urban, suburban, and underserved regional corridors worldwide.
The technological architecture of modern 5G FWA setups
relies on utilizing mid-band (Sub-6 GHz) and high-band millimeter-wave (mmWave)
radio frequencies to match or exceed the download and upload speeds achieved by
conventional wired broadband networks. In standard deployment models, telecom
operators establish high-capacity 5G macro gNodeB base stations equipped with
massive Multiple-Input Multiple-Output (MIMO) antenna arrays and advanced
beamforming capabilities. These base stations direct narrow, concentrated radio
beams straight toward fixed Customer Premises Equipment (CPE) antennas mounted
on the exterior walls or inside the windows of subscriber properties. This
setup bypasses the costly, slow, and disruptive process of digging trenches to
lay physical cables over the "last mile" of network distribution.

The global shift toward leveraging mmWave 5G configurations
represents another critical technological milestone highlighted within the
industry framework. While mid-band spectrum deployments offer broad geographic
coverage and excellent building penetration for standard residential packages,
mmWave solutions unlock ultra-high data throughput speeds exceeding several
gigabits per second alongside ultra-low network latency. This high performance
allows telecom providers to easily offer premium enterprise-grade connectivity,
support multi-user high-definition streaming environments, and lay down the
reliable, low-latency communication networks needed to support autonomous
material handling, municipal traffic automation, and industrial IoT arrays.

Key Drivers and Market Dynamics
The primary market momentum is driven by the significant
cost-efficiency and fast installation timelines associated with wireless
broadband configurations compared to legacy wired deployments. With businesses
and consumer segments requiring immediate access to gigabit-tier data networks,
operators face high pressure to replace aging copper lines without incurring
the massive capital costs and permitting delays tied to municipal fiber
trenching projects. However, market dynamics are also shaped by the technical
challenges of radio signal attenuation caused by physical obstructions, extreme
weather patterns, and the heavy power requirements of high-frequency mmWave
transceiver nodes. To improve service reliability, leading telecommunications
component designers are focusing on expanding their portfolios of high-gain
smart antenna modules and rolling out intelligent self-installation CPE devices
that guide consumers to the optimal signal location within their property,
streamlining customer onboarding.

What is Customer Premises Equipment (CPE) in a 5G FWA
network?
CPE refers to the specialized hardware routers, modems, or
external antennas installed at the subscriber's location to receive 5G cellular
signals and convert them into standard local Wi-Fi or Ethernet connectivity.
How does 5G FWA compare to traditional fiber-optic
installations?
5G FWA eliminates the need for expensive physical cable
installation down the last mile, offering similar gigabit speeds with
significantly faster deployment times and lower initial capital costs.
What spectrum bands are utilized by 5G FWA platforms?
They leverage a combination of mid-band (Sub-6 GHz)
frequencies for broad, reliable coverage and high-band Millimeter-Wave (mmWave)
frequencies for ultra-fast, gigabit-tier data transmission over shorter
distances.
